2

当调用

 tkFileDialog.askopenfile()

tkinter中的方法,如何将默认目录设置为用户的主目录?有没有办法独立于操作系统来做到这一点,或者这是程序员必须处理的事情?

4

1 回答 1

5

os.path.expanduser('~')应该在大多数操作系统(windows,unix)上为您扩展它......

换句话说:

home = os.path.expanduser('~')
f = tkFileDialog.askopenfile(initialdir = home)
于 2012-12-17T22:12:42.570 回答